Use "wellspring" in a sentence | "wellspring" example sentences

How to use "wellspring" in a sentence?

  • It's important to resolve to yourself, 'I will absolutely win!' Then this firm commitment will serve as the wellspring of great wisdom and courage that surges forth from within.
    -Daisaku Ikeda-
  • The United States Supreme Court, once a reliable if ultimate recourse for progressive and even revolutionary grievances, has become a retrograde wellspring for enormous economic and social distress.
    -June Jordan-
  • I don't actually have a one wellspring of inspiration. Though I'm most often inspired while reading - both fiction and nonfiction.
    -James Rollins-
  • The market is the creator of social wealth and the wellspring of self-sustaining economic development.
    -Li Keqiang-
  • Compassion is the heart that never stops loving others. It is like a wellspring that never runs dry.
    -Ryuho Okawa-
  • Dig within. There lies the wellspring of good.
    -Marcus Aurelius-
  • I don't believe we're only motivated by our own self-interests. Often out of crisis comes this enormous wellspring of generosity and motivation.
    -Josh Fox-
  • Disappointment is an endless wellspring of comedy inspiration.
    -Martin Freeman-

Definition and meaning of WELLSPRING

What does "wellspring mean?"
wellspring

noun
An original and bountiful source of something..
